This document is subject to change without notice. 1VV0301859 Rev 0 Page 6 of 21 2023-08-31 WE310K6-P EVB (CS2446a-A) Hardware User Guide 4 WE310K6-P Interface Description 4.1 WE310K6-P Development Kit There is provision to mount both WE310K6 LGA module and WE310K6 M.2 card on to EVB. To route signals from any one of these modules to connectors is done by placing jumpers. WE310K6-P EVB screenshots are given below: 1VV0301859 Rev 0 Page 7 of 21 2023-08-31 WE310K6-P EVB (CS2446a-A) Hardware User Guide Figure 1: WE310K6-P EVB This table lists the information related to WE310K6-P Kitting Parts. Table 2: WE310K6 Kitting Parts Description Quantity EVB Board 1 Power cable 1 USB Type-C cable 1 Wi-Fi/BT Antenna 2 4.2 Evaluation Board Description Note that both WE310K6 LGA module and WE310K6 M.2 cannot be used together in EVB. Only one can be used at a time. 1VV0301859 Rev 0 Page 8 of 21 2023-08-31 WE310K6-P EVB (CS2446a-A) Hardware User Guide 5 WE310K6-P Interface Description 5.1 WE310K6-P Development Kit Figure 2: WE310K6-P EVB Top View Table 3: EVB Description 1 SMA Antenna Connector 2 LED's 3 PCM option LGA or M.2 (PL300) 4 PCM I/0 level option (PL301) 5 PCM Connector at codec (PL302) 6 Audio Jack 7 MHF Antenna Connector 8 WE310K6-P LGA Module 9 UART I/0 level option (PL200) 10 UART option LGA or M.2 (PL201) 14 BT/WL WAKE option LGA or M.2 (PL501) 15 PCIe CLKREQ option LGA or M.2 (PL404) 16 Pull-up voltage option for BT WAKE LGA (PL504) 17 PCIe WAKE option LGA or M.2 (PL403) 18 Codec I2C, VDDIO LGA (PL500) 19 Power Supply Connector 20 PCIe RESET option LGA or M.2 (PL402) 21 1.8V I/O for codec and FTDI chip (PL100) 22 I/O level option for LGA (PL101) 23 PCIe option LGA or M.2 (PL401) 1VV0301859 Rev 0 Page 9 of 21 2023-08-31 WE310K6-P EVB (CS2446a-A) Hardware User Guide 11 USB type-C connector 12 M.2 BT/WL Enable option (PL503) 13 LGA BT/WL Enable option (PL502) 24 Power source selection (PL400) 25 PCIe x1 finger 26 WE310K6-P M.2(Key-E) slot 5.2 Anteena Connector Insert the antenna cable assembly into the respective SMD type MHF Antenna connector. Antenna cable assembly is common for both LGA and M.2 card. Connect the Antenna into the SMA connector. 5.3 UART Figure 3: Antenna Connectors Figure 4: PL200 UART I/O Level Header PL200 1-2: UART I/O Level is 3.3V. PL200 3-4: UART I/O Level is 1.8V (Default jumper config). PL200 5-6: UART Voltage-Level Translator 1.8V input pin. Insert a jumper when setting the I/O level to 3.3V. 1VV0301859 Rev 0 Page 10 of 21 2023-08-31 WE310K6-P EVB (CS2446a-A) Hardware User Guide Figure 5: PL201 UART Selection Header PL201 1-2: UART signals to M.2 card. PL201 2-3: UART signals to LGA Module (Default jumper config). 5.4 PCM Figure 6: PL300 PCM Selection Header PL300 1-2: PCM signals to M.2 card. PL300 2-3: PCM signals to LGA Module (Default jumper config). Figure 7: PL301 PCM I/O Level Header PL301 1-2: PCM I/O Level 3.3V. PL301 3-4: PCM I/O Level 1.8V (Default jumper config) PL301 5-6: PCM Voltage-Level Translator 1.8V input pin. Insert a jumper when setting the I/O level to 3.3V. 1VV0301859 Rev 0 Page 11 of 21 2023-08-31 WE310K6-P EVB (CS2446a-A) Hardware User Guide Figure 8: PL302 PCM signals Isolation Header at Codec PL302 1-2: PCM CLK pin. (Default jumper config) PL302 3-4: PCM SYNC pin. (Default jumper config) PL302 5-6: PCM TX pin. (Default jumper config) PL302 7-8: PCM RX pin. (Default jumper config) 5.5 Audio Jack Audio from/to codec MAX9867EWV+T (from analog devices) is routed to the 3.5mm audio Jack SO300. Figure 9: SO300 Audio jack 5.6 LED There are three LEDs on the EVB. Figure 10: LED Indicate LED_PWR: Indicates 3.3 supply is present. LED_WL: Indicates Wi-Fi is enabled. LED_BT: Indicates Bluetooth is enabled. 1VV0301859 Rev 0 Page 12 of 21 2023-08-31 WE310K6-P EVB (CS2446a-A) Hardware User Guide 5.7 USB The USB type-C is connected to USB to UART converter FTDI chip. This is useful to connect the WE310K6 UART port to PC for testing Bluetooth. Connect the USB Type-C cable included with the EVB into the USB connector. Figure 11: USB Type-C port Figure 12: USB Type-C cable 5.8 PCIe Insert EVB's PCIe finger into the host PCIe slot. As per the PL401 jumper setting, the host PCIe signals are routed to LGA module or M.2 card. Figure 13: PCIe finger 1VV0301859 Rev 0 Figure 14: PL401 PCIe Signal Routing Selection Header Page 13 of 21 2023-08-31 WE310K6-P EVB (CS2446a-A) Hardware User Guide Figure 15: PCIe Control Signals Routing Headers PL402 1-2: PCIe reset signal to LGA module (Default jumper config). PL402 2-3: PCIe reset signal to M.2 card. PL403 1-2: PCIe WAKE signal to LGA module (Default jumper config). PL403 2-3: PCIe WAKE signal to M.2 card. PL404 1-2: PCIe CLKREQ signal to LGA module (Default jumper config). PL404 2-3: PCIe CLKREQ signal to M.2 card. 5.9 EVB Power Supply Configuration Figure 16: EVB Power Supply Configuration There are two ways to supply power to the EVB: Through host PCIe socket or External power supply connector. To supply power from external DC power supply, connect the power cable included with the EVB into the connector SO401 and place jumper on PL400 2-3. Figure 17: Power cable PL400 1-2: 3.3V main power is supplied through the PCIe socket (Default jumper config). PL400 2-3: 3.3V main power is supplied through external DC power supply. PL101 1-2: 1.8V I/O level LGA module (Default jumper config). 1VV0301859 Rev 0 Page 14 of 21 2023-08-31 PL101 2-3: 3.3V I/O level LGA module. WE310K6-P EVB (CS2446a-A) Hardware User Guide Figure 18: EVB Power Supply Configuration PL504 1-2: 3.3V pull-up to BT_WAKE_HOST pin of LGA Module (Default jumper config). PL504 3-4: I/O(1.8Vor3.3V) pull-up on BT_WAKE_HOST pin of LGA Module. PL500 1-2: I/O(1.8Vor3.3V) pull-up on HOST WAKE BT&WL (LGA module), HOST WAKE BT&WL (M.2) pin (PL501). PL500 3: Codec I2C_SCL PL500 4: Codec I2C_SDA PL100 1-2: 1.8V I/O power for codec (Default jumper config). PL100 3-4: 1.8V I/O power for FTDI chip (Default jumper config). 5.10 TEST Header Header for BT and Wi-Fi Disable. Figure 19: PL502 Test Header for LGA Module PL502 1-2: LGA module BT_DIS pin for functional test. PL502 3-4: LGA module WL_DIS pin for functional test. PL502 5-6: LGA module BT_WAKE_HOST pin for functional test. Not e: Do not place the jumpers on this connector for normal operation. 1VV0301859 Rev 0 Page 15 of 21 2023-08-31 WE310K6-P EVB (CS2446a-A) Hardware User Guide Figure 20: PL503 Test Header for M.2 PL503 1-2: M.2 BT_DIS pin for functional test. PL503 3-4: M.2 WL_DIS pin for functional test. PL503 5-6: M.2 BT_WAKE_HOST pin for functional test. Not e: Do not place the jumpers on this connector for normal operation. Figure 21: PL501 Test Header for LGA and M.2 PL501 1-2: M.2 HOST_WAKE_WL pin for functional test. PL501 3-4: M.2 HOST_WAKE_BT pin for functional test. PL501 5-6: LGA module HOST_WAKE_WL pin for functional test (Default jumper config). PL501 7-8: LGA module HOST_WAKE_BT pin for functional test (Default jumper config). Not e: Either LGA module or M.2 card must be present on EVB. Test only one form factor. 1VV0301859 Rev 0 Page 16 of 21 2023-08-31 WE310K6-P EVB (CS2446a-A) Hardware User Guide 6 WE310K6-P Basic Operations 6.1 General Information on Power Supply The EVB can be powered in two ways. 1 3.3V power can be supplied from the HOST PCIe slot. 2 3.3V power can be supplied from external DC power supply.
